As of June 22, 2026, Gold Resource Corporation (GORO) has a Wall Street consensus price target of $2.00, based on estimates from 4 covering analysts. With the stock currently trading at $1.33, this represents a potential upside of +50.4%. The company has a market capitalization of $183M.
Analyst price targets range from a low of $2.00 to a high of $2.00, representing a 0% spread in expectations. The median target of $2.00 aligns closely with the consensus average. The tight target dispersion indicates high conviction among analysts.
The current analyst consensus rating is Buy, with 3 analysts rating the stock as a Buy or Strong Buy,0 rating it Hold, and 1 rating it Sell or Strong Sell. This overwhelmingly bullish sentiment suggests analysts see significant catalysts for upside ahead.
From a valuation perspective, GORO trades at a trailing P/E of -28.3x and forward P/E of 26.6x. Analysts expect EPS to grow +24.1% over the next year.
